After a roaring success last year, The Suffolk is returning with the biggest New Year’s Eve party on the East End. The Suffolk 54 New Year’s Eve on Sunday, December 31, at 10 p.m. is a throwback to the disco days of Studio 54 and music by Long Island’s favorite disco group That 70’s Band. Partygoers can dance their way into the new year with the music of Earth Wind and Fire, The Commodores, Donna Summer, KC and the Sunshine Band, Chic, Bee Gees and so many more.

The night will feature an open dance floor, hats, noisemakers and streamers, exclusive one-night-only menu offerings and specialty cocktails available to purchase. There will also be a live-stream of the Times Square Ball Drop and a complimentary champagne toast at midnight.

Tickets are $125, plus applicable fees, at thesuffolk.org. Suffolk Theater is at 118 East Main Street in Riverhead.
